First Impressions of Costa Rica

Costa Rica

As the Spring 2019 SFS students begin to settle into their new homes around the world, we asked them to share their impressions of the experience so far. Ben Lefkowitz had this to say about SFS Costa Rica:

 
Why did you choose to study abroad with SFS?
I chose SFS because it was the perfect mix of exposing me to a new culture with a structured school program. It also had a good combination of most of my interests while giving me an excellent way to leave my comfort zone.

 
What are your first impressions of the country?
That it is a wonderful and gorgeous place that has a lot of environmentalism built into the culture. Costa Rica a country that is quickly growing and becoming more environmentally friendly but still has a lot of work to do to make it as great as it can be. I have not been here long, but I am already falling in love.

 
What are your first impressions of the field station?
A place that very quickly became home. It was more beautiful than I was expecting, with lots of places to study in. I love how the campus is small enough to get anywhere quickly but big pretty enough to feel like I am walking through a jungle farm to get to breakfast each day. The fact that I can pick fruit to eat on my walk to class is one of my favorite parts.

 
What do you think the biggest challenge will be for you this semester, both academically and culturally?
I feel that academically the biggest challenge will be keeping up with the readings in such a busy schedule. I think culturally the biggest challenge will be the language barrier.

 
What are you looking forward to the most about the semester?
I am looking forward to getting to know the country much better and bonding with my cohort.

 
Give three words that best describe how you are feeling right now.
Thankful, Amazed, Grateful
